Abstract
The article presents a short overview of the controlled polymerization of (meth)acrylates assisted with Li tert.butoxide as the stabilizer o f active centres. The ''living'' homopolymerizations of 2-ethylhexyl a crylate, butyl acrylate and allyl methacrylate, and the synthesis of f ully-acrylate block copolymers are given as examples. The reaction con ditions always need to be tuned up with respect to the monomer. The st abilizing effect of lithium 3-methylpentoxide-3, which seems to be a h ighly efficient type of the tert. alkoxide stabilizing additive, is br iefly shown.
